What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ing describes a kind of window construction that includes 2 panes of glass sealed together, with a space in between that is generally filled with argon gas. This design lowers heat transfer and minimizes the possibilities of condensation, making homes more comfy and energy-efficient.

Installing double glazing involves a few crucial steps. Below is a detailed breakdown of the installation procedure:
1. Consultation and Measurement
Before installation starts, house owners need to seek advice from with an expert double glazing company. Throughout this phase, measurements of the existing window frames are taken, enabling personalized window services.
2. Selecting the Right Glazing
House owners have a choice of several kinds of double glazing, including:
Standard Double Glazing: Basic two-pane glass setup.Low-E Glass: Coated with a material to reflect heat back into the home.Acoustic Glass: Designed specifically for sound decrease.
The option depends upon private requirements and climate factors to consider.
3. Removal of Existing Windows
When the kind of glazing has actually been chosen, the installation team gets rid of the old windows carefully, making sure the surrounding area remains undamaged.
4. Installation of New Frames
New frames are then set up to fit the double-glazed systems. The frames can be made from various materials including uPVC, wood, or aluminum.
5. Insertion of Double Glazed Units
The sealed double-glazed panes are fitted into the new frames. This action is essential to guarantee appropriate insulation and performance.
6. Sealing and Finishing Touches
Once the systems are in location, they are sealed using high-quality sealants to prevent air and water leakages. Any completing touches are finished, such as painting or weather condition removing.
7. Final Inspection
The installation group carries out a last evaluation to guarantee everything is perfect before finishing the project.

Q1: How much does double glazing installation cost?A1: The cost differs
based on window size, type of glass, frame material, and complexity of the installation. On average, house owners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 400 to ₤ 800 per window, including products and labor.
Q2: Is double glazing worth the investment?A2: Yes, while the upfront
costs can be substantial, double glazing can cause substantial savings on energy costs, improve comfort levels, and increase home worth over time. Q3: How long does double glazing last?A3: With appropriate upkeep, double-glazed windows can last 20 to 35 years, making them a
long-term financial investment for homeowners. Q4: Can I install double glazing myself?A4: While DIY installation is possible, it is suggested to hire experts to make sure correct fitting, sealing, and insulation, which can prevent future concerns
. Q5: Will double glazing get rid of all noise?A5: While double glazing substantially decreases sound, it might not eliminate it totally.
